Welcome aboard! If you're building a plugin for LintLadle, you'll bump into the baseline file (`ladle-baseline.json`) pretty quickly. It's a snapshot of all known warnings in the host codebase, so your plugin's new findings stand out instead of drowning in old noise. Don't edit it by hand — regenerate it with `ladle bake` after your plugin stabilizes. Committing a stale baseline is the number-one cause of flaky CI runs. For the full regeneration workflow and gotchas, see the baseline guide.

dashboard of yafog-fajof = https://jira.tolvaqsys.internal/pages/pages/projects/49fe21c4

**Q: What happens when Mailcull marks a bounce as permanent?**

Mailcull, our email bounce processor, classifies hard bounces after three consecutive failures and suppresses the address automatically. Soft bounces are retried for 72 hours. If the suppression list itself becomes corrupted, restore it from the encrypted nightly snapshot in the Thornfield backup bucket. Restoring requires the team recovery passphrase, which is kept directly below this entry for emergencies.

unlock words, kahof-bahap: praax-ulaix

## Authentication — Dedupo

Quick primer before the eng sync: Dedupo collapses duplicate on-call alerts before they hit Pagerline. It authenticates to the internal Alertbus with a static service key — yes, we know, rotation work is tracked for next quarter. Local dev uses the shared staging key, which is safe to pass around the team but shouldn't leave the repo wiki. For staging runs, use the key below.

gateway credential: kto3_qfe